PAST EXHIBITION

Tina Vietmeier and Catherine Dudley

June 11, 2008—July 26, 2008

This series of landscapes by Bay Area artist Tina Vietmeier was influenced by her developing interest in Global Warming, particularly the rapid deterioration of the North and South Poles caused by human endeavor.  Vietmeier creates a visual dialogue that making connections between our daily lives and what is happening to these natural habitats. They push back and forth between realism and abstraction and often include snippets of information, drawings and collage elements such as paper and used stamps.  Known for her use of encaustic, Vietmeier carefully crafts an ethereal milky cosmos of wax and imagery.
